summ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orPeng Huang <shawn.p.huang@gmail.com>2009-12-13 08:35:10 +0800
committerPeng Huang <shawn.p.huang@gmail.com>2009-12-13 08:35:10 +0800
commit4728ea9371fd8db91d971f1bfaf404c0437081c2 (patch)
tree8126deefb9181dd37cbcc33f4ebe886352c1c6d6
parent34a762ae03bf4840f98aed803ca71ad870072ca4 (diff)
downloadibus-libpinyin-4728ea9371fd8db91d971f1bfaf404c0437081c2.tar.gz
ibus-libpinyin-4728ea9371fd8db91d971f1bfaf404c0437081c2.tar.xz
ibus-libpinyin-4728ea9371fd8db91d971f1bfaf404c0437081c2.zip
Create databases' indexes in build time.
-rw-r--r--ibus-pinyin.spec.in13
1 files changed, 7 insertions, 6 deletions
diff --git a/ibus-pinyin.spec.in b/ibus-pinyin.spec.in
index 0366c20..edf95c7 100644
--- a/ibus-pinyin.spec.in
+++ b/ibus-pinyin.spec.in
@@ -17,7 +17,7 @@ BuildRequires: sqlite-devel
BuildRequires: libuuid-devel
BuildRequires: ibus-devel >= 1.2.0
-Requires(post): sqlite
+# Requires(post): sqlite
Requires: ibus >= 1.2.0
@@ -43,7 +43,8 @@ make %{?_smp_mflags}
%install
rm -rf $RPM_BUILD_ROOT
-make DESTDIR=${RPM_BUILD_ROOT} NO_INDEX=true install
+# make DESTDIR=${RPM_BUILD_ROOT} NO_INDEX=true install
+make DESTDIR=${RPM_BUILD_ROOT} install
%find_lang %{name}
@@ -51,12 +52,12 @@ make DESTDIR=${RPM_BUILD_ROOT} NO_INDEX=true install
rm -rf $RPM_BUILD_ROOT
%post
-cd %{_datadir}/ibus-pinyin/db
-sqlite3 android.db ".read create_index.sql"
+# cd %{_datadir}/ibus-pinyin/db
+# sqlite3 android.db ".read create_index.sql"
%post open-phrase
-cd %{_datadir}/ibus-pinyin/db
-sqlite3 open-phrase.db ".read create_index.sql"
+# cd %{_datadir}/ibus-pinyin/db
+# sqlite3 open-phrase.db ".read create_index.sql"
%files -f %{name}.lang
%defattr(-,root,root,-)